"So, you dance on street corners, huh?" 😉 By all rights, these two should have been competitors (and the press often painted them as such), but they simply refused! Instead, they became the best of friends. 🥰 There's one story, in particular, which I think illustrates the depth of their relationship...When Gene's wife died of cancer, he was understandably devastated. One evening, he was sitting alone, when there was a knock at the door. He ignored it, but the knocker persisted. Finally, Gene yelled, "There's nobody home", to which Fred replied, "I know...That's why I came to be with you". 🥺 Fred (who had brought some food), sat quietly with Gene all night. 😭 It turns out, that Gene had done the same for Fred, when his wife died from cancer, years earlier. 😔 These two were both so lovely, and their friendship was just precious. 🥺 Fred Astaire & Gene Kelly, in "Ziegfeld Follies" (1945). 💕
